WhatsApp Chat

Programming Foundations with JavaScript, HTML and CSS

Build a strong foundation in web development with Duke University. This beginner-friendly course teaches HTML, CSS, and JavaScript through hands-on projects, preparing students and professionals to create interactive and responsive websites.

Course Preview

๐Ÿ“… Duration

16 Weeks

๐ŸŽ“ Certification

IvySchool.ai + Duke University Partner

๐Ÿ’ป Mode

Online + Live

Program Overview

Learn the fundamentals of web development by creating real projects with HTML, CSS, and JavaScript. Perfect for beginners, this course provides a solid base for future web and software development learning.

HTML & CSSJavaScriptResponsive DesignWeb ProjectsProblem Solving

Students will create web pages, style them with CSS, and add interactivity using JavaScript. By the end, learners will have multiple projects and be ready for more advanced web development courses.

Who Is This Program For?

Beginners or anyone looking to start web development

School Students

Learn coding and website basics

College Students

Build foundational web development skills

Young Professionals

Start building web apps before learning advanced frameworks

๐Ÿ”ฅ Early Bird Special

Complete Course

โ‚น12999โ‚น3999Limited Time

  • โœ… 3 comprehensive modules
  • โœ… 30+ interactive lessons
  • โœ… Duke University certificate
  • โœ… Beginner-friendly
  • โœ… Lifetime access to materials
๐Ÿ“… Duration: 16 Weeks๐Ÿ‘ฅ Cohort Size: 50 Students

Limited time offer ยท Full payment plan available ยท 30-day money-back guarantee

Learning Outcomes

By the end of this course, youโ€™ll be able to build responsive websites, write interactive JavaScript code, and understand the core concepts of web development.

๐Ÿ“˜ Understand Web Basics

Learn HTML structure, CSS styling, and core JavaScript

๐ŸŽฎ Build Interactive Pages

Create dynamic websites with interactive elements and forms

๐ŸŽจ Express Creativity

Design visually appealing web pages and UI components

๐Ÿš€ Prepare for Advanced Web Development

Build confidence to transition into frameworks like React, Node.js, or full-stack development

Comprehensive Curriculum

3 modules, 30+ lessons, 16 weeks of beginner-friendly web development

๐Ÿ“‘ Key Topics

  • HTML tags, structure, and semantics
  • CSS fundamentals and styling
  • Layouts with Flexbox and Grid
  • Responsive design basics
  • Colors, fonts, and typography
  • Creating static web pages

๐Ÿ’ป Hands-on Projects

  • Build your first personal webpage
  • Style pages using CSS and Flexbox

Ready to Start Your Web Development Journey?

Join hundreds of students who are already building websites with HTML, CSS, and JavaScript.

โณ

16 Weeks

Learning

๐Ÿ‘ฅ

Limited Seats

Enroll Today

๐ŸŽ“

Duke University

Partnered

๐Ÿ“œ

Certificate

Upon Completion

40% Off ยท Limited Time

โ‚น12999

โ‚น3999

One-time payment ยท Full course access

โœ… 30-day money-back guarantee ยท โšก Instant access after payment